(CNN) The Senate confirmed Tom Vilsack as President Joe Biden's agriculture secretary, sending the former Iowa governor to the same Cabinet position he served for the entirety of the Obama administration. During his confirmation hearing earlier this month, Vilsack made clear the challenges facing the Department of Agriculture are different than 12 years ago. "The world and our nation are different today than when I served as agriculture secretary in a previous administration," Vilsack said. Biden called him, "The best secretary of agriculture I believe this country has ever had." In 2009, the Senate unanimously confirmed Vilsack to be agriculture secretary.
